Brighton Central School District serves students across kindergarten through high school in the Rochester, New York area. The district aims to deliver an engaging, inclusive, and rigorous education that supports students academically, socially, and emotionally to prepare them for adulthood. With hundreds of staff members, the district operates a comprehensive K-12 program to meet a broad range of student needs and goals. Recent developments include recognition of district leadership, notably Kevin McGowan receiving the National Superintendent of the Year award in February 2023 from the American Association of School Administrators. In 2020 the district launched an online tool to help students and families focus on mental health during the holidays. In 2017 the district partnered with the Kids Miracle Making Club and Rochester Institute of Technology to promote STEAM service learning.
